How they compare
United Arab Emirates currently reports 3.92 against 3.86 in Gambia, a difference of 0.06.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 23 shared years of data; in 1990 it was United Arab Emirates ahead.
Gambia ranks 65th and United Arab Emirates ranks 62nd of 189 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Gambia averaged higher in 2 and United Arab Emirates in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Gambia | United Arab Emirates |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 2.86 | 3.44 | 0.5764 | United Arab Emirates |
| 2000s | 3.36 | 2.9 | 0.4532 | Gambia |
| 2010s | 3.83 | 3.77 | 0.0595 | Gambia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
